General Description The EC9522T is protection IC for over-charge/discharge of rechargeable one-cell Lithium-ion(Li+) excess load current, further include a short circuit protector for preventing large external short circuit current. Each of these IC is posed of three voltage detectors, a reference unit, a delay circuit, a short circuit protector, and a logic circuit. When charging voltage crosses the detector threshold from a low value to value higher than VDET1, the output of Cout pin, the output of over-charge detector/VD1, switches to low level, charger’s negative pin level. After detecting over-charge the VD1 can be reset and the output of Cout bees high when the VDD voltage is ing down to a level lower than “VREL1”, or when a kind of loading is connected to VDD after a charger is disconnected from the battery pack while the VDD level is in between “VDET1” and “VREL1” in the EC9522T.
